What is the primary function of military innovation in Integrated Defense?

Explanation:
The primary function of military innovation in Integrated Defense is to adapt to changing threats and improve operational strategies and technologies. This adaptability is essential in countering evolving security challenges and maintaining a strategic advantage. As the nature of warfare and threats continuously evolve—through technological advancements, shifts in geopolitical landscapes, and emerging conflicts—military forces must innovate in order to enhance their effectiveness and flexibility on the battlefield. Innovation enables military organizations to develop new tactics, leverage advanced technologies, and update their doctrines to meet the demands of contemporary security environments. This could involve integrating cyber capabilities into traditional combat operations, using artificial intelligence to improve decision-making processes, or developing new forms of warfare that address hybrid threats. By prioritizing innovation, militaries can respond more effectively to unforeseen situations and adversaries, ensuring they remain capable and relevant in the face of uncertainty and complexity.
